this product Accurate Super Taq HS DNA Polymerase I is genetically modified to provide high thermal stability, excellent amplification efficiency, amplification speed, amplification sensitivity and amplification specificity.
This product also contains an additive that can inhibit the production of chemical substances at room temperature. Accurate Super Taq The monoclonal antibody to DNA Polymerase I activity is optimized to maintain strict containment of the polymerase at 55°C, which can effectively inhibit non-specific amplification. When the reaction is kept at 95℃ for more than 30 sec, the monoclonal antibody is completely inactivated and the polymerase can be completely released, which makes the PCR system highly specific and sensitive, and improves the accuracy of the results.

HS DNA Polymerase I has 5’→3' DNA polymerase activity and 5'→3' exonuclease activity without 3'→5' exonuclease activity, and is suitable for a wide range of Taq DNA Polymerase-based PCR and qPCR reactions; the PCR product obtained with this product has an A base at the 3' end, and can be cloned directly into T vector.
1. High thermal stability: the half-life of heating at 95℃ is more than 1 hour.
2. High amplification efficiency: the extension time for fragments up to 1 kb is only 1 sec, and the extension time for fragments up to 2 kb can be shortened to 1 ~ 5 sec.

*: 10X Super Taq HS PCR Buffer I (Mg2+ plus) composition: 100 mM Tris-HCl (pH 8.9 at 25°C), 500 mM KCl, 50 mM MgCl2
